Prior to Registering or Scheduling Proctoring Services

Exam and proctoring information needs to be emailed to us at testing@tamu.edu before we can schedule you. We will not be able to schedule you until this information is received from the professor/instructor or institution. WE WILL NOT REACH OUT TO THE INSTITUTION OR PROFESSOR FOR THIS INFORMATION.

The Day of Your Exam

Scheduling:

We do not schedule same-day for testing. Scheduling needs to be at least 24 business hours in advance. 

IF YOU ARE LATE FOR YOUR APPOINTMENT YOU WILL BE ASKED TO RESCHEDULE

 

Information needed from the institution/professor:

  • Student's name that is expected to take the test
  • Time limit
  • Materials allowed
  • Expiration date
  • If online; we will need the website and whether a lockdown browser is required
  • If paper-based; we will need to be sent the exam so we can print it out. Additionally, we will need the email of who the completed test will need to be scanned/sent to.

**Please note that this information needs to come directly from the institution or professor NOT THE STUDENT. We will not contact the institution or professor for this information.

The Day of Your Exam

What to Bring:


You will need to arrive 15 minutes prior to your scheduled test session with an unexpired government issued ID that contains a photo. One of the following is acceptable:
  • Driver's License
  • Passport
  • Texas Department of Public Safety Identification Card
  • Current Permanent Residence Card
  • TAMU Student ID

    If a minor is testing, a Parental Release Form will need to be signed and a parent or legal guardian is required to accompany the student.

    Whoever accompanies the student will also have to present a valid ID from the list above.

    Any personal materials that the professor allows is your responsibility to provide. Scratch paper and pencils will be provided for the exam.
     

    Without an acceptable ID you will not be permitted to test.

What to Expect:

 

Upon arrival, you will present your ID to the proctor. They will confirm the test that you are taking and will assign you a locker with a lock and key that you will be asked to store all your belongings in. You will be asked to empty your pockets and take off all jewelry.

No outside jackets are allowed but you can take a thin or light jacket into the testing room. No hats or scarves allowed.

You will go through a  security check and will be asked to show your arms and legs. You will be asked to turn pockets inside out so be aware that clothing with numerous pockets will cause a longer check-in process.
You will be explained the rules of your exam and given scratch paper and pencils if you wish and then seated for the exam. A proctor monitors the testing room at all times.

After Your Exam:

 

Distance education exams are graded by the professor and exam results are not available in our office. Students should contact their professor for grades.
